Fabulous two-story home located at Heath Golf and Yacht Club in Heath! Private home office at the front of the house, as well as an extra suite with ensuite bath and walk-in closet. Great room features a cozy center fireplace and a wall of windows that floods the room with sunlight. Kitchen has quartz countertops, light stain shaker cabinets, and stainless steel appliances. Three secondary bedrooms, a hall bath, a welcoming loft space, and entertaining media room located on the second floor.

Using techniques centuries old, the enameler applies layers of vitreous enamel powder to a metal base, firing it in a kiln after each application to create a deep, luminous, and incredibly durable surface. Grand Feu enamel is a risk-laden art; a single mistake during firing can crack or discolor the entire piece, forcing the artisan to start anew.
